Barbara Brackman was one of the first members of the American Quilt Study Group and is proud to be the author of the first paper in the first volume of Uncoverings. She is a free-lance writer who specializes in quilt history, women's history, and western history. Among her books are Americas Printed Fabrics, 1770-1890 and Encyclopedia of Pieced Quilt Patterns. She is a member of the Quilters Hall of Fame and honorary curator of quilts at the Spencer Museum of Art at the University of Kansas.
